Output dbf1b76b5d7959ca7b4ddfab5a655aaaee5e962c0ec9b5cb33aefa03923a7b0e:15

value
16152666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001dc696f6129b9a00e42509790a6b33c188f54a OP_EQUAL
address
M7umuHUo6Np3pWbqrakHgJx3Dz6ngzLY7a
transaction
dbf1b76b5d7959ca7b4ddfab5a655aaaee5e962c0ec9b5cb33aefa03923a7b0e
spent
true